Personal experiences from studying fashion in Paris this past summer is where most of my inspiration

comes from. Specifically, a day at the Dior Gallerie. Picture this: a young 18 year old girl stumbling

upon a never-ending hallway of Christian Dior’s best designs. Behind the physical garment stands a

screen, a screen with a recording of the model walking the runway in that particular garment. This is a

moment that I’ll never forget as it taught me a model’s job, which is to bring the designs to life. I will

forever be inspired to bring each and every garment to life and convey its story.

Don’t be afraid to put yourself out there and build connections with people. It may seem very intimidating but showing that you’re interested in pursuing this career and taking action will put you at a higher success rate. Also do your research on the industry. The more knowledgeable you are to the industry as well as developing model skills, the better it is to create a career for yourself in this industry. And most importantly, don’t let rejection discourage you, this industry is full of rejection and you will hear more no’s than yes’s. But don’t let those rejections define who you are and where you want to be. Keep working hard and you can achieve anything you put your mind towards.
